Saint-Majorique sits in the heart of the Centre-du-Québec region, a stretch of the province defined by the St. Francis River valley, rolling agricultural land, and the kind of unhurried rural character that the city of Drummondville — just minutes away — has long called its backyard. Golf in this part of Quebec carries a distinctly community feel, courses serving as social anchors through a season compressed by hard winters and fully embraced the moment the frost lifts in spring.
Le Drummond presents an 18-hole, par-72 layout that fits the mold of a regional Quebec club: rooted in its landscape, built for members and locals rather than destination travelers, and measured by the loyalty of the players who return year after year. The surrounding terrain — gently rolling, threaded with mature trees and seasonal water — gives a course of this type its natural bones, and in this corner of Quebec those bones tend to favor classic parkland sensibilities over dramatic elevation or resort theatrics.
For golfers exploring Quebec beyond the flagship resort tracks, clubs like Le Drummond represent the honest core of the province's game — accessible, unpretentious, and genuinely reflective of where they're planted.
| Tee | Yards | Rating | Slope | Par |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| Noir · men | 7,048 | 73.7 | 144 | 72 |
| Bleu · men | 6,716 | 72.2 | 139 | 72 |
| Hybride · men | 6,420 | 70.7 | 136 | 72 |
| Blanc · men | 6,108 | 69.1 | 125 | 72 |
| Vert · men | 5,738 | 67.4 | 116 | 71 |
| Vert · women | 5,738 | 72.9 | 131 | 72 |
| Jaune · men | 5,526 | 66.4 | 112 | 70 |
| Jaune · women | 5,526 | 71.7 | 125 | 72 |
| Rouge · women | 4,863 | 67.8 | 116 | 71 |
